Hi, Tyler Retzlaff

We found an error when ASAN test, AddressSanitizer: stack-buffer-overflow error when quit testpmd.
Could you please have a look at it , also submitted a Bugzilla ticket: https://bugs.dpdk.org/show_bug.cgi?id=1166

> Subject: [PATCH v6 1/3] eal: add rte thread create control API
> 
> Add rte_thread_create_control API as a replacement for
> rte_ctrl_thread_create to allow deprecation of the use of platform specific
> types in DPDK public API.
> 
> Add test from David Marchand to exercise the new API.

> @@ -98,6 +98,39 @@ int rte_thread_create(rte_thread_t *thread_id,
>   * @warning
>   * @b EXPERIMENTAL: this API may change without prior notice.
>   *
> + * Create a control thread.
> + *
> + * Creates a control thread with the given name and attributes. The
> + * affinity of the new thread is based on the CPU affinity retrieved
> + * at the time rte_eal_init() was called, the EAL threads are then
> + * excluded. If setting the name of the thread fails, the error is
> + * ignored and a debug message is logged.
> + *
> + * @param thread
> + *   Filled with the thread id of the new created thread.
> + * @param name
> + *   The name of the control thread
> + *   (max RTE_MAX_THREAD_NAME_LEN characters including '\0').
> + * @param thread_attr
> + *   Attributes for the new thread.
> + * @param thread_func
> + *   Function to be executed by the new thread.
> + * @param arg
> + *   Argument passed to start_routine.
> + * @return
> + *   On success, returns 0; on error, it returns a negative value
> + *   corresponding to the error number.
> + */
> +__rte_experimental
> +int
> +rte_thread_create_control(rte_thread_t *thread, const char *name,
> +		const rte_thread_attr_t *thread_attr,
> +		rte_thread_func thread_func, void *arg);
